Description | Steve Crain notes: Condition census example of scarcest variety for this date. Date slopes uphill, from left to right. Struck from severely rusted obverse die (due to New Orleans climate). Rust pits most noticeable in shield and in date numerals, also in gown. REV Large O ( |
